NEW YORK: Kenyan-born Australian teen Makur Maker, a cousin of NBA player Thon Maker, and Cameroonian forward Paul Eboua, who played in Italy, are entering the 2020 NBA Draft, ESPN reported on Saturday (Sunday in Manila). Maker, 19, is a mobile big man with ballhandling skills who impressed scouts last summer with a Southern California amateur club. Detroit Pistons forward Thon Maker and Matur Maker, who plays on a Houston Rockets developmental team, are his cousins. Eboua, 20, told ESPN he has submitted paperwork to the NBA to ensure his draft eligibility. “This last year in Pesaro was a great experience for me,” Eboua told ESPN.
